The Vibrant Heart of Santorini

Fira, the capital of Santorini, is a bustling hub of activity, perched on the edge of the island’s iconic caldera. Known for its stunning views, vibrant nightlife, and rich cultural offerings, Fira is a must-visit destination that captures the essence of Santorini. Whether you’re seeking history, adventure, shopping, or dining, Fira has something for everyone.

Cultural and Historical Experiences

Museum of Prehistoric Thera

Museum of Prehistoric Thera

This museum houses artifacts from the ancient city of Akrotiri, providing insight into the island’s history and the Minoan civilization.

Archaeological Museum of Thera

Archaeological Museum of Thera

Here, you can explore a collection of sculptures, pottery, and other artifacts from various periods of Santorini’s history.

Catholic Cathedral of St. John the Baptist

Catholic Cathedral of St. John the Baptist

Located in the Catholic quarter of Fira, this cathedral is an architectural gem, featuring beautiful frescoes and a peaceful ambiance.

05 / Fira Restaurants

Dining

From traditional Greek tavernas serving time-honored recipes to upscale restaurants offering contemporary twists on Mediterranean classics, Fira’s dining options cater to every palate and occasion.

Argo Restaurant

Argo Restaurant

Argo is known for its elegant atmosphere and creative takes on Greek cuisine. The menu features dishes like lobster pasta, seafood risotto, and lamb shank, all prepared with fresh, local ingredients.

Idol Restaurant

Idol Restaurant

With its chic design and sophisticated menu, Idol offers a modern dining experience in the heart of Fira. The menu includes contemporary Mediterranean dishes such as seared tuna, truffle-infused pasta, and innovative desserts.

Naoussa Tavern

Naoussa Tavern

A beloved spot among locals and visitors alike, Naoussa Tavern offers classic Greek dishes like moussaka, grilled octopus, and fresh seafood. Located near the edge of the caldera, it also provides stunning views of the sunset.
